Tracking inflationKey points Price level is measured by constructing a hypothetical basket of goods and services—meant to represent a typical set of consumer purchases—and calculating how the total cost of buying that basket of goods increases over time. The rate of inflation is measured as the percentage change between price levels over time....0 Commentaires 0 Parts 13KB Vue 0 Aperçu

Demand and the Determinants of DemandIn a competitive market, demand for and supply of a good or service determine the equilibrium price. The law of demand Markets have two agents: buyers and sellers. Demand represents the buyers in a market. Demand is a description of all quantities of a good or service that a buyer would be willing to purchase at all prices. According to the law of demand, this relationship...0 Commentaires 0 Parts 16KB Vue 0 Aperçu
